Cooked by: Chef / Last Modified: 3/24/2004 / Base: Beef / Difficulty: Easy / Preparation Time: 30-60 Minutes / Number of Servings: 6 |
|
|
Directions: #1 Heat oven to 350'F
#2 Mix thoroughly; 1/4 soup, ground beef, bread crumbs, egg, onion, amd pepper
#3 shape into 6 patties. Place in shallow baking dish, bake for 30 minutes
#4 Drain. combine remaining soup with water. Pour over patties. Bake for 10 minutes
Ingredients: 1 Ounce(s) generous black pepper 1/4 finely chopped onion, yellow 1 slightly beaten egg 1/2 bread crumbs, whole wheat 2 Pound(s) ground beef 1 Can(s) cream of mushroom soup 1/3 Cup(s) water |
